Abstract

An adjustable three-section therapeutic bed belongs to the field of medical instruments, wherein bed plates of the therapeutic bed are in a three-section structure and are hinged with each other, a second bed plate at the middle position is in a lifting structure, a lifting mechanism is arranged at the lower part of the second bed plate, a first bed plate and a third bed plate which are hinged at two ends of the second bed plate are inclinable bed plates, the lower parts of the inclinable bed plates are respectively provided with an inclining mechanism, and the heights of the first bed plate and the third bed plate are lifted along with the lifting of the second bed plate; the angle position of each bed board is controlled by the tilting mechanism, the position suitable for treating patients can be reached, the three-section bed is convenient to use, simple in structure, low in manufacturing cost, easy to operate and convenient to use.

Detailed Description
In order to make the technical field of the present invention better understand the scheme of the present invention, the present invention is further described in detail with reference to the accompanying drawings and embodiments. For a better understanding of the invention, in the following detailed description, the active state is shown with a dashed line, in the following orientation, which refers to the position facing the long side of the treatment couch.
The utility model relates to an adjustable three-section type treatment bed, which is shown in figure 1 as a structural stereogram of the utility model. Fig. 2 is a front view of the structure of the present invention. The treatment bed includes chassis 11, the sharp push rod 17 that is used for going up and down, the bed board of treatment bed is the syllogic bed board, and is articulated each other between the syllogic bed board, and the second bed board 15 that sets up at the intermediate position is lift type structure, and the lower part is provided with elevating system including sharp push rod 17, and first bed board 14, the third bed board 16 of second bed board 15 both ends articulated respectively are inclinable bed board, and inclinable bed board lower part is provided with the tilting mechanism including the air spring respectively, and the height of first bed board, third bed board is gone up and down along with the lift of second bed board. Fig. 1 shows the use of the bed board. Specifically, including the horizontal position and the inclined position of the first bed plate 14 and the third bed plate 16, the therapist can perform manual treatment on the patient at any position.
Referring to fig. 1 and 2, four bottom wheels 20 are mounted at four corners of the therapeutic bed chassis 11, and the bottom wheels 20 are used for moving the therapeutic bed on the ground. The bottom wheel 20 is provided with a locking mechanism, and when needed, the locking mechanism is used for locking, so that the rolling of the bottom wheel 20 can be prevented, and the treatment bed can be stably placed. The upper end of the underframe 11 is provided with four supporting frames 101, and the upper ends of the two supporting frames 101 are respectively hinged with the middle mounting holes of the left tripod 13a and the right tripod 13b through horizontal supporting shafts. The left tripod 13a and the right tripod 13b are provided with an upper mounting hole, a middle mounting hole and a lower mounting hole, so that a long arm of the upper mounting hole relative to the middle mounting hole and a short arm of the lower mounting hole relative to the middle mounting hole are formed. The two groups of four supporting frames 101 are combined into a rectangular body, and the left tripod 13a and the right tripod 13b are respectively hinged on a middle horizontal supporting shaft of the four supporting frames 101. Two or two sets of tripods are: a left tripod 13a and a right tripod 13 b. The lower mounting holes (short arm sides) of the left tripod 13a and the right tripod 13 are respectively hinged at two ends of the connecting rod 12, the lower end in the middle of the connecting rod is provided with a fixed plate, one end of the linear push rod 17 is hinged at the right end of the underframe 11, and the other end of the linear push rod 17 is hinged on the fixed plate at the lower end in the middle of the connecting rod 12.
In the present embodiment, two left tripods 13a and two right tripods 13b are used.
Fig. 3 is a partial schematic view of the lifting mechanism of the present invention. A pair of left support plates 501 and a pair of right support plates 502 are respectively arranged at two ends of the lower part of the second bed plate 15, pin shafts are respectively arranged between the lower ends of the pair of left support plates 501 and the pair of right support plates 502, and the lower ends of the pair of left support plates 501 and the pair of right support plates 502 are respectively hinged in upper mounting holes of the pair of left tripods 13a and the pair of right tripods 13b through pin shafts. When the linear push rod 7 extends, the long arms of the left tripod 13a and the right tripod 13b are driven by the connecting rod 12 to change in the vertical direction, so that the second bed plate 15 is lifted in the vertical direction, and the horizontal position is displaced.
Fig. 4 is a partial schematic view of the bed board assembly of the present invention. A pair of left support plates 501, a pair of right support plates 502, a left connecting plate 503 and a right connecting plate 504 are respectively arranged below the second bed board 15. The second bed board 15 is hinged to the first bed board 14 through a left connecting plate 503, a first air spring 18 is installed below the left end of the first bed board 14, a supporting rod of the first air spring 18 is connected with one side of the outer short side below the first bed board 14, and an air cylinder end of the first air spring 18 is installed on a pair of left supporting plates 501 of the second bed board 15. The first gas spring 18 is a position locking type gas spring, so that the first gas spring 18 can be locked at any angle to support the first bed plate 14 to be inclined relative to the second bed plate 15, that is, the inclination angle of the first bed plate is α.
The second bed board 15 is hinged with the third bed board 16 through a right connecting plate 504, a second gas spring 19 is installed below the right end of the third bed board 16, and a supporting rod of the second gas spring 19 is connected with the lower part of the third bed board 6. The cylinder end of the second gas spring 19 is mounted on the support plate 502 of the second bed plate 15. The second gas spring 19 is a position locking type gas spring. The second gas spring 19 can thus be locked at any angle to support the third deck 16 in a position inclined in relation to the second deck 15, i.e. at a third deck inclination angle beta.
The locking function of first gas spring 18 and second gas spring 19 is prior art.
The first bed board 14 and the third bed board 16 are respectively installed on the second bed board 15, so that the lifting mechanism can lift the first bed board and the third bed board together with the second bed board 15 along the vertical direction.
The utility model discloses in the use, return pulley 20 locks. The patient lies on the treatment bed or lies on the treatment bed, and the second bed board 15 is driven to adjust the height through the extension or the shortening of the linear push rod 17. The suitable position for the therapist to use is reached. Then, the therapist adjusts the inclination angle of the first bed plate 14 by the first gas spring 18 of the tilting mechanism, and adjusts the inclination angle of the third bed plate 16 by the second gas spring 19 of the tilting mechanism, so as to facilitate the manipulation or massage use of the therapy.
